个人简介

Ph.D. Materials Chemistry (2012) Northwestern University BA / M.S. Inorganic Chemistry (2008) Northwestern University

研究领域

Dr. Ringe's current interests include atomic resolution and three dimensional elemental mapping of alloy nanoparticles relevant for catalysis applications, as well as near-field plasmon mapping using electron energy loss spectroscopy.
